Barriers in providing quality end-of-life care as perceived by nurses working in critical care units: an integrative review.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Despite increasing interest in quality end-of-life care (EOLC), critically ill patients often receive suboptimal care. Critical care nurses play a crucial role in EOLC, but face numerous barriers that hinder their ability to provide compassionate and effective care.

METHODS

An integrative literature review was conducted to investigate barriers impacting the quality of end-of-life care. This review process involved searching database like MEDLINE, Cochrane Central Register of Controlled Trials, CINAHL, EBSCO, and ScienceDirect up to November 2023. Search strategies focused on keywords related to barriers in end-of-life care and critical care nurses from October 30th to November 10th, 2023. The inclusion criteria specified full-text English articles published between 2010 and 2023 that addressed barriers perceived by critical care nurses. This integrative review employs an integrated thematic analysis approach, which combines elements of deductive and inductive analysis, to explore the identified barriers, with coding and theme development overseen by the primary and secondary authors.

RESULTS

Out of 103 articles published, 11 articles were included in the review. There were eight cross-sectional descriptive studies and three qualitative studies, which demonstrated barriers affecting end-of-life care quality. Quality appraisal using the Mixed Method Appraisal Tool was completed by two authors confirmed the high credibility of the selected studies, indicating the presence of high-quality evidence across the reviewed articles. Thematic analysis led to the three main themes (1) barriers related to patients and their families, (2) barriers related to nurses and their demographic characteristics, and (3) barriers related to health care environment and institutions.

CONCLUSION

This review highlights barriers influencing the quality of end of life care perceived by critical care nurses and the gaps that need attention to improve the quality of care provided for patients in their final stages and their fsmilies within the context of critical care. This review also notes the need for additional research to investigate the uncover patterns and insights that have not been fully explored in the existing literature to enhance understanding of these barriers. This can help to inform future research, care provision, and policy-making. Specifically, this review examines how these barriers interact, their cumulative impact on care quality, and potential strategies to overcome.

摘要

背景

尽管人们对高质量的临终关怀(EOLC)越来越感兴趣,但危重病患者通常仍得不到最佳的治疗。重症监护护士在 EOLC 中起着至关重要的作用,但他们面临着许多障碍,这阻碍了他们提供富有同情心和有效的治疗的能力。

方法

进行了一项综合文献综述,以调查影响临终关怀质量的障碍。这个综述过程包括搜索数据库,如 MEDLINE、Cochrane 中央对照试验注册中心、CINAHL、EBSCO 和 ScienceDirect,截止到 2023 年 11 月。搜索策略集中在与临终关怀障碍和重症监护护士相关的关键词上,时间为 2023 年 10 月 30 日至 11 月 10 日。纳入标准规定了 2010 年至 2023 年期间发表的全文为英文的文章,这些文章涉及重症监护护士所感知到的障碍。本综合综述采用综合主题分析方法,该方法结合了演绎和归纳分析的元素,以探讨确定的障碍,主要和次要作者对编码和主题开发进行监督。

结果

在发表的 103 篇文章中,有 11 篇文章被纳入综述。其中有八篇是横断面描述性研究,三篇是定性研究,这些研究表明存在影响临终关怀质量的障碍。由两位作者完成的使用混合方法评估工具进行的质量评估证实了所选研究的高可信度,表明在综述的文章中存在高质量的证据。主题分析导致了三个主要主题:(1)与患者及其家属有关的障碍,(2)与护士及其人口统计学特征有关的障碍,以及(3)与医疗保健环境和机构有关的障碍。

结论

本综述强调了影响重症监护护士感知的临终关怀质量的障碍,以及需要关注的差距,以改善重症患者在其生命末期及其家属的护理质量。本综述还指出需要进行更多的研究,以调查现有文献中尚未充分探讨的模式和见解,以增强对这些障碍的理解。这有助于为未来的研究、护理提供和决策提供信息。具体而言,本综述考察了这些障碍是如何相互作用的,它们对护理质量的累积影响,以及克服这些障碍的潜在策略。
